Understanding Gas Water Heater Line Features

When considering affordable gas water heater options, understanding the features of the various models in the gas water heater line is crucial. The market offers a wide array of choices, each with unique specifications that cater to different needs and budgets. A key aspect to focus on is energy efficiency, which directly impacts running costs over time. Look for heaters with high Energy Star ratings, indicating superior energy performance compared to standard models. For instance, the latest generation of condensing gas water heaters can boost efficiency by up to 95%, significantly reducing utility bills.
Another important feature is the size and capacity of the heater, which should align with your household’s hot water demands. Heaters come in various capacities measured in gallons, typically ranging from 40 to 100 gallons or more. A larger capacity may be beneficial for families with higher hot water usage, such as those with multiple occupants or energy-intensive activities. Choosing the Best Budget-Friendly Model for Your Home

Choosing an affordable gas water heater doesn’t have to mean sacrificing quality or performance. When navigating the market for a budget-friendly option, it’s essential to consider factors like energy efficiency, size appropriate for your home, and features that offer both convenience and long-term savings. Many reputable manufacturers offer gas water heater line solutions designed to compete with more expensive models in terms of output and durability.
For instance, consider the popular Energy Star-rated models from brands like Rheem and Bradford White. These units often boast annual energy savings of 10% to 25% compared to standard models, translating to lower utility bills over time. When selecting a size, remember that the right fit depends on your household’s hot water usage. According to the U.S. Department of Energy, an average family of four uses approximately 86 gallons of hot water daily. A 40-gallon tank might suffice for smaller households, while larger families may benefit from 50 or 75-gallon models.
